Comprehending Headset Types
The marketplace is flooded with headset options categorized mainly into 3 types: wired, wireless, and noise-canceling headsets. Each type serves particular needs and has special features. Here's a breakdown of what each type offers:
1. Wired Headsets
Wired headsets make use of cables for audio connection. They are often favored for their consistent sound quality and no latency.
Pros:
- No battery needed
- Typically higher sound fidelity
- More economical compared to wireless choices
Cons:
- Limited range due to cables
- Potential tangling concerns
2. Wireless Headsets
Wireless headsets connect via Bluetooth or radio frequency. They supply flexibility of motion, making them perfect for active users.
Pros:
- Greater movement
- No wires to manage
- Often come geared up with advanced functions (like touch controls)
Cons:
- Requires charging
- Can experience connection concerns or latency
3. Noise-Canceling Headsets
Noise-canceling headsets are created to reduce ambient sounds, making them exceptional for focused listening environments.
Pros:
- Enhanced audio quality due to lowered diversions
- Ideal for travel or open office settings
Cons:
- Typically more pricey
- Bulkier style may be less comfy for extended usage
Summary Table of Headset Types
Feature | Wired Headsets | Wireless Headsets | Noise-Canceling Headsets |
---|---|---|---|
Connection | Wired (3.5 mm/USB) | Bluetooth/Radio | Bluetooth/Active Noise Control |
Sound Quality | High | Moderate to High | High |
Price Range | ₤ ₤ | ₤ ₤ - ₤ ₤ ₤ | ₤ ₤ ₤ |
Battery Requirement | No | Yes | Yes |
Movement | Restricted | Outstanding | Good |
Functions to Consider
When choosing a headset, concentrating on particular functions can help tailor choices further. Here's a list of vital functions to think about:
- Sound Quality: Look for headsets with high fidelity and balanced noise profiles.
- Microphone Quality: Essential for gaming and virtual conferences, select headsets with clear voice pick-up.
- Convenience: Cushioned ear cups and adjustable headbands are essential for extended use.
- Battery Life: For wireless headsets, examine the length of time the battery lasts and the time it takes to recharge.
- Sturdiness: A robust construct will ensure durability, especially for on-the-go users.
- Compatibility: Check compatibility with your devices (PC, consoles, mobile phones, etc).

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What should I prioritize: sound quality or features?
It depends upon your primary usage case. If you prioritize audio for music or video gaming, focus on sound quality. If you require flexibility (like calls, video gaming, and media), consider feature-rich alternatives.
2. Are wireless headsets worth the investment?
Yes, specifically for users who value movement and benefit. Just make sure to monitor battery life and connectivity stability.
3. How important is sound cancellation in a headset?
Noise cancellation is crucial for individuals in noisy environments, such as workplaces or while traveling. It can enhance focus and total listening experience.
4. Can I utilize headsets for video calls?
Definitely. Most contemporary headsets come with built-in microphones and are designed particularly for voice clarity during calls.
5. How do I preserve and care for my headset?
- Store them in a protective case
- Clean the ear cups and microphone regularly
- Prevent extending the cable televisions
